Understanding the Core Differences

Before diving into the comparison, it’s essential to understand what each battery type offers. LiPo (Lithium Polymer) batteries have been the industry standard for drone applications for over a decade. These batteries are known for their high energy density and relatively lightweight properties. However, they come in fixed capacities and designs, limiting customization options. A typical LiPo battery might be designed for a specific drone model with a predetermined capacity, making it difficult to adapt to unique operational requirements.

On the other hand, modular battery systems represent a newer approach where batteries are designed as interchangeable units that can be combined to achieve desired capacity and voltage. Each module contains its own battery management system (BMS), allowing for greater flexibility and scalability. This design philosophy enables operators to tailor battery solutions precisely to their drone’s needs without compromising performance.

Key Comparison Points: Performance, Safety, and Customization

Weight and Capacity Considerations

Weight is a critical factor in drone performance, directly affecting flight time, maneuverability, and payload capacity. According to a 2023 study by the International Association for Unmanned Systems (IAUS), every additional gram of battery weight can reduce flight time by 1-2%.

  • LiPo Batteries: Typically offer high energy density (250-300 Wh/kg), but their fixed capacity means operators often carry excess weight for missions that don’t require the full capacity. For example, a 5000mAh LiPo battery used for a 30-minute mission might be unnecessarily heavy for the task.
  • Modular Batteries: Allow for precise capacity matching by adding or removing modules. A modular system could provide a 3000mAh configuration for a shorter mission and scale up to 6000mAh for extended operations without carrying unnecessary weight. This approach can reduce overall battery weight by up to 25% compared to using a single oversized LiPo battery.

Safety and Reliability

Battery safety is paramount in drone operations, especially for commercial applications where failures can lead to costly equipment damage or safety hazards. The FAA reports that battery-related incidents account for approximately 15% of all drone safety incidents.

  • LiPo Batteries: While generally safe when used properly, they’re prone to swelling and potential fire risks if damaged, overcharged, or exposed to extreme temperatures. A single point of failure in a LiPo battery can compromise the entire system.
  • Modular Batteries: Incorporate redundant safety features at the module level. If one module fails, the rest can continue operating, significantly reducing the risk of complete system failure. Each module’s independent BMS ensures balanced charging and discharging, enhancing overall safety. A recent case study from a major drone inspection company showed a 40% reduction in battery-related incidents after switching to modular systems.

Customization Flexibility

The ability to customize battery solutions is increasingly important as drone applications become more specialized.

  • LiPo Batteries: Limited customization options. Most manufacturers offer a small range of standard capacities and form factors. For instance, a commercial drone operator might find only three standard battery options that don’t perfectly match their drone’s unique power requirements.
  • Modular Batteries: Offer unparalleled customization. Operators can create battery systems that precisely match their drone’s electrical specifications, weight constraints, and operational needs. For example, a drone designed for agricultural monitoring might require a battery with specific voltage output for its sensors and cameras, which a modular system can provide without compromising other performance factors.

Real-World Application Scenarios

Agricultural Monitoring

Modern agricultural drones require extended flight times to cover large fields efficiently. A farmer using a drone for crop monitoring might need a battery that provides 45 minutes of flight time to cover 100 acres.

  • LiPo Solution: The operator might be limited to a standard 5000mAh battery offering 35 minutes of flight time, requiring multiple battery swaps and reducing overall efficiency.
  • Modular Solution: A custom 6000mAh configuration using modular batteries could provide the necessary 45 minutes of flight time without excess weight, allowing for more efficient field coverage and reduced downtime.

Industrial Inspection

Drones used for inspecting infrastructure like bridges and power lines operate in harsh environments where reliability is critical.

  • LiPo Solution: Standard batteries might not withstand extreme temperature variations common in outdoor inspections, leading to unexpected shutdowns.
  • Modular Solution: Customized modular batteries can incorporate waterproofing and temperature-resistant components specifically designed for industrial conditions, ensuring consistent performance in challenging environments.

Logistics and Delivery

As drone delivery services expand, the need for reliable, fast-charging batteries becomes paramount.

  • LiPo Solution: Standard batteries might require 90 minutes for a full charge, limiting the number of deliveries per day.
  • Modular Solution: Modular systems can be designed with fast-charging capabilities, reducing charging time to 45 minutes while maintaining high capacity for multiple delivery cycles.

Making the Right Choice for Your Operations

Choosing between modular and LiPo batteries isn’t a one-size-fits-all decision. The right choice depends on your specific operational requirements, budget constraints, and long-term business goals.

For standard recreational or light commercial use with predictable mission profiles, LiPo batteries may provide sufficient performance at a lower cost. However, for businesses requiring extended flight times, specialized environmental resistance, or scalability across multiple drone models, modular batteries offer significant advantages.
